→Scope: Proposals innovations should address one or more of the several domains : WBG substrates to reduce EU dependency on material and provide more sustainable, industrially compatible solutions. WBG platform for cost effectiveness, available in 300mm for GaN and/or SiC to improve yield and power density and close gaps in the value chain. A toolbox (e.g. wafer cut, smart stacking, thin layer transfer, epitaxy, UWBG materials) for further innovation schemes. Next generation or optimised new power semiconductor devices fitting their application. Adding intelligence to power semiconductor devices on control and/or sensor side. Facilitate the propagation of EU Packaging/Integration excellence along the entire value chain e.g. pre-packages or power semiconductor device packaging solutions to enable power device/system integration and strengthen Europe’s competitiveness in advanced packaging. Explore the use of heterogeneous and functional integration for improved performance, reliability, robustness and cost competitiveness. →Expected Outcome: Proposals submitted to this call are expected to address several of the following elements: • Scaling of wafer-level photonic processes for key materials (e.g. SiN, InP, GaAs),including process integration, yield optimisation, and manufacturability at highvolumes. • Development of packaging and test solutions that are scalable, automated, andcompatible with co-packaged optics and advanced photonic-electronic integration. • Integration of heterogeneous materials and components, such as on-chip lasers,modulators, and detectors, using advanced packaging and assembly approaches. • Design-process-equipment co-optimisation, enabling repeatable, cost-effectiveproduction of complex photonic circuits and systems, including use of PDKs andvalidated building blocks. • Demonstration of system-level functionality through application-relevant use casesin strategic sectors (e.g. AI, sensing, telecommunication, mobility, health, defence),with quantified performance metrics and clear market relevance.
